Saskatoon teen injured, charged after being struck by a vehicle

Police have charged Saskatoon teen with riding a bike on a sidewalk after he was hit by a vehicle while crossing an intersection. File / Global News

A Saskatoon teen has been charged after he was hit by a vehicle while crossing an intersection on his bicycle.

Police say the 15-year-old boy was riding his bike eastbound on the sidewalk along Diefenbaker Drive just before 6 p.m. CT on Thursday.

As he went to cross the road at Laurier Drive, he was struck by a vehicle making a left turn from Laurier to Diefenbaker.

The teen was taken to hospital with non-life threatening injuries.

Police have charged him with riding a bike on the sidewalk.

No charges have been laid against the driver.
